Arsenic treated lumber is not being sold, but other pressure treated wood will be safe to use for your raised beds. Composite lumber and cedar lumber will both be safe and will last a long time for raised beds.
Raised beds are gardening structures where soil is elevated above the surrounding ground level, typically enclosed by wooden, stone, or metal frames. They improve drainage, provide better soil quality, and make gardening more accessible by reducing the need to bend over. Raised beds can enhance plant growth by warming the soil earlier in the spring and can help control weeds and pests more effectively. They are popular in both home gardens and community gardening projects.
Using a soaker hose in raised beds for gardening can help conserve water by delivering moisture directly to the roots of plants, reducing water waste from evaporation. It also promotes healthier plants by preventing water from splashing on leaves, which can lead to diseases. Additionally, soaker hoses are easy to install and can be hidden under mulch, providing a more efficient and aesthetically pleasing watering system for raised beds.

sunken beds are dug into the ground making the flowerbed lower than the existing terrain. a raised bed is usually walled around and then filled in with dirt or loam thereby raising the bed above its surroundings.
To effectively practice gardening on pavement and concrete surfaces, you can use containers or raised beds to create a suitable growing environment. Ensure proper drainage by drilling holes in the containers or beds. Use lightweight soil mixes and consider using vertical gardening techniques to maximize space. Regularly water and fertilize your plants, and choose plants that are well-suited for container gardening.

To effectively create raised beds on concrete for your garden, you can use materials like wooden planks or cinder blocks to build the raised bed structure. Make sure to create drainage holes in the bottom of the bed and fill it with a mix of soil, compost, and other organic matter. Consider adding a layer of landscape fabric to prevent weeds from growing. Water the raised beds regularly and choose plants that are suitable for container gardening.
